一、
:CC攻击对响影的能性统系对系统性能的影响
CC攻击,即Challenge Collapsar攻击,是一种典型的应用层DDoS攻击。它通过模拟正常用户行为,大量发送请求,消耗服务器资源,导致服务不可用。保障网站系统性能对于企业和个人都至关重要。本文将深入剖析CC攻击的原理,并提出相应的防御策略。
二、CC攻现表与理原击的原理与表现
2.1 原析分理原理分析
CC攻击。源资量大器务主要利用代理服务器向目标服务器发送大量请求,这些请求在表面上看似正常,但实际上却会消耗服务器大量资源。
- 僵尸网络攻击者通过恶意软件或僵尸网络控制大量主机,组成攻击集群。
- 代理攻击攻击者通过代理服务器发送请求,模拟正常用户行为,迷惑防御系统。
- 资源耗尽大量请求导致服务器资源耗尽,服务崩溃。
2.2 典型表现
CC攻击的主要表现如下:
- 服务器负载过高服务器CPU、内存、带宽等资源消耗过大,导致服务响应变慢甚至崩溃。
- 网站访问缓慢用户访问网站时,页面加载缓慢,甚至无法打开。
- 系统崩溃服务器因资源耗尽而崩溃,导致业务无法正常运行。
三、CC攻击的防御策略
3.1 硬防策略
硬防策略主要从物理层面提高服务器防护能力,包括:
- 硬件防火墙部署专业的硬件防火墙,对进出流量进行监控和过滤。
- 负载均衡使用负载均衡设备,分散请求,减轻服务器压力。
3.2 代码层防御策略
代码层防御策略主要针对应用层进行优化,包括:
- 验证用户身份使用验证码、双因素认证等措施,防止恶意用户攻击。
- 限制请求频率对用户的请求频率进行限制,防止恶意请求占用服务器资源。
3.3 第三方程序防御策略
第三方程序防御策略主要利用第三方软件或服务进行防护,包括:
- 入侵检测系统部署入侵检测系统,实时监控网络流量,发现异常行为。
- CDN服务使用CDN服务,将静态资源缓存到全球节点,减轻服务器压力。
四、实际案例与数据支撑
以某知名电商网站为例,该网站曾遭受严重的CC攻击。通过采取以下措施,成功抵御了攻击:
- 部署硬件防火墙使用硬件防火墙对进出流量进行过滤,有效防止恶意请求。
- 使用负载均衡通过负载均衡设备,将请求分散到多台服务器,减轻单台服务器的压力。
- 实施代码层防御对用户请求进行验证和频率限制,防止恶意用户攻击。
通过以上措施,该网站成功抵御了CC攻击,确保了业务正常运行。
通过本文的介绍,我们可以了解到CC攻击对系统性能的严重危害,以及相应的防御策略。在实际应用中,应根据业务需求和攻击特点,选择合适的防御策略组合,并建立持续的性能监控体系,确保系统始终保持最优状态。
- 定期进行安全审计和漏洞扫描及时发现并修复潜在的安全漏洞。
- 与云安全服务提供商、CDN提供商等合作共同应对CC攻击,提高防御能力。
- 制定应急预案和演练确保在攻击发生时,能够迅速响应。
应对CC攻击需要多方面的努力,通过综合防御措施的应用,才能保障网站系统性能的安全稳定。